Sidewalks lining new neighborhoods throughout the southern U.S. might quickly be lit by solar-powered streetlights made by a startup firm in Tampa.

Streetleaf, headquartered in Tampa with about 15 workers, introduced that it is inked a take care of the nation’s largest homebuilder, D.R. Horton. Streetleaf will present its streetlights for a few of D.R. Horton’s new developments in fast-growing, sunny locales like Texas, Arizona, southern California and the broader Southeast.

Liam Ryan, Streetleaf’s CEO, stated the settlement is a breakthrough to convey the solar-powered know-how towards wider adoption.

“It’s almost like crossing the chasm,” Ryan stated in an interview. “We’re going from just early adopters to now, mainstream customers are taking what Streetleaf is doing seriously.”

The corporate’s streetlights every have a photo voltaic panel and battery that may cost up in just a few hours and maintain shining for 3 to 5 days of full cloud cowl, Ryan stated. They will take as little as quarter-hour to put in as a result of there is not any want to attach them to the electrical grid, a serious promoting level for builders who may have to regulate the areas of streetlights as they construct.

In addition they save residents cash, Ryan stated, since householders in D.R. Horton subdivisions are sometimes answerable for the prices of sustaining streetlights of their neighborhoods.

The corporate put in its first gentle in 2019 within the Epperson growth in Wesley Chapel. So far, it is put in about 7,500 lights, no less than half of that are in Tampa Bay neighborhoods, significantly in Pasco County and japanese Hillsborough.

The corporate estimates its streetlights have prevented round 2.6 million kilos of carbon dioxide emissions up to now. The know-how additionally has dimming choices, together with movement sensing, that may scale back gentle air pollution.

“We just saw this niche opportunity of bringing modern technology to this often neglected, key infrastructure,” Ryan stated.

Streetleaf’s photo voltaic streetlights in North Fort Myers withstood Hurricane Ian two years in the past and saved a neighborhood there lit for 4 to 5 days after whereas the facility was nonetheless out, Ryan stated.

This resilience helped persuade D.R. Horton to cement its relationship with the startup.

“Sustainable infrastructure is highly attractive to homeowners, and the added peace of mind that comes with knowing the lights are designed to remain operational even during many extreme weather events like hurricanes is equally important,” Brad Conlon, senior vp of enterprise growth for D.R. Horton, stated in a press release.

Streetleaf expects its settlement with the homebuilder to result in no less than 10,000 new streetlight installations yearly, greater than doubling its variety of put in lights within the first 12 months. The startup declined to supply a greenback determine for the way a lot the deal is value.
